I watched the first four episodes of The Stand with J last night and it was better than I thought it was going to be.

*warning: some revision and plot details*


...
..
.


The revised script is tightly focused on the main characters and jumps around the timeline, so if you are an OG King text diehard (like me) this is might make your jaw clench at the opening scene until you get a better feel for what the writers are trying to do with all the timeline jumps. I will admit it took me a while to get over the shock of the series opening with the characters already in Boulder. I thought I started with the wrong episode or that the stream had jumped way ahead or something. I also smirked when I realized they had updated the story to the modern era, but that may or may not work better to retain viewers. It's not like 1990 is such a monumental era to revisit since these modern superflu viruses are very... timely. As much as I enjoy all the apocalyptic detail in the book, it is really about the main characters and the series is running with that. They have removed all the other mini vignettes and micro storylines, and people get together quickly and their stories get told immediately. There are other revisions to bring things closer together and move the story along at a faster pace. I like most of the characters except would have preferred anybody other than Whoopi Goldberg as Mother Abigail. I'm not sold on Skarsgård yet, but I'm willing to give him a chance as they have not given him that much screen time yet. If Vegas is too much of a lurid clown show this could still end up being a disappointment, but I'm going to give it a chance.

I'll give quick input on what I've seen...

14. Scare Me - this one is worth a watch but it's not great. Interesting concept, runs a little long and is more impressive for it's concept than what actually unfolds

10. Underwater - I actually loved this. I expected to hate it. Definitely watch it. It's basically Alien set under water. Big budget horror sci-fi is hard to come by these days.

8. Swallow - Slow, interesting and uncomfortable. Recommend checking this one out

7. His House - this was really good. I knew nothing about it going into it and I think that helped. I recommend checking it out.

6. Get Duked! - I got 10 minutes into this and shut it off. I couldn't stand the characters

4. The Invisible Man - didn't work for me. It's poorly thought out from a world building and logic perspective, they ignore so much to make a "cool scene". Elizabeth Moss is great though, the best part of the film. Direction is very good too, just some terrible logic leaps and bad sci-fi bullshit. Also the film loses it's tension about 30 minutes in and never recovers.

2. The Dark and the Wicked - this one is on the list, hoping to watch it this week but heard lots of good things about it.
